I am feeling very tired after taking L-Cin OZ, and I am not sure if this is a side effect or something serious. Should I continue this medicine or stop it now?
Feeling tired after starting L-Cin OZ can sometimes happen as a mild side effect because it is an antibiotic combination, and such medicines may cause weakness, nausea, or a general low energy feeling in some people while the body is adjusting. It can also feel more noticeable if you are already recovering from an infection, not eating well, or dehydrated, so the timing of the symptom matters a lot. However, not every tired feeling means the medicine is harmful. If the tiredness is mild and you are otherwise stable, it may settle as your body adapts, but if you also notice symptoms like severe weakness, dizziness, fast heartbeat, vomiting, rash, breathing difficulty, or worsening overall condition, it should not be ignored. In those situations, medical review is important. It is not a good idea to stop antibiotics on your own because incomplete treatment can sometimes make the infection return or become resistant. The safer step is to speak with your doctor who prescribed it and explain the side effects so they can decide whether to continue, adjust, or change the medicine based on your condition. Staying well hydrated and taking light meals can also help reduce fatigue while on treatment.
